Subject: [PATCH v7 0/9] dm: Add programmatic generation of ACPI tables (part A)
Date: Sun, 19 Apr 2020 14:36:48 -0600 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20200419203657.163143-1-sjg@chromium.org> (raw)
This is split from the original series in an attempt to get things applied
in chunks.
v7 is just a rebase as requested
Changes in v7:
- Rebase to master
Changes in v5:
- Drop bisectability changes
Changes in v4:
- Put 'interrupts-extended' property on one line
- Rename acpi-probed to linux,probed
- Note that linux,probed is an out-of-tree feature
- Separate out the log newline
- Update comment in acpi_inc_align() to show the alignment
- Put back cast on table_compute_checksum()
- Rename list_fact() to list_fadt()
- Add a comment to dump_hdr()
Changes in v3:
- Drop mention of PRIC
- Rename acpi,desc to acpi,ddn
- Correct description of acpi,probed
- Drop hid-descr-addr
- Just add the device.txt binding file in this patch
- Change the example to ELAN
- Add a pointer to information about acpi,compatible
- Rename acpi_align_large() to acpi_align64()
- Fix 'RSDP' typo
- Fix 'XDST' typo
- Move acpi_align_large() out of dm_test_acpi_setup_base_tables()
- Beef up the comment explaining how the unaligned address is used
Changes in v2:
- Fix definition of HID
- Infer hid-over-i2c CID value
- Add the hid-over-i2c binding document
- Drop definition of ACPI_TABLE_CREATOR
- Make _acpi_write_dev_tables() static and switch argument order
- Generalise the ACPI function recursion with acpi_recurse_method()
Simon Glass (9):
acpi: Add a binding for ACPI settings in the device tree
acpi: Add a method to write tables for a device
acpi: Convert part of acpi_table to use acpi_ctx
x86: Allow devices to write ACPI tables
acpi: Drop code for missing XSDT from acpi_write_rsdp()
acpi: Move acpi_add_table() to generic code
acpi: Put table-setup code in its own function
acpi: Move the xsdt pointer to acpi_ctx
acpi: Add an acpi command
